TWO men on a tricycle on Friday robbed a convenience store in Angeles City, Pampanga.
In a report to Police Regional Office 3 director Brig. Gen. Jose Hidalgo Jr., Angeles City police director Col. Amado Mendoza Jr. said robbed was the Alfamart store in Sitio Santol, Bgy. Tabun.
Store crew member Wendy Isla, 43, of Bgy. Sapalibutad, Angeles City; and Razel Mae Consa, 27, of Cutud, Angeles City, informed the police of the robbery.
According to employees, two men on a tricycle pulled over in front of the Alfamart store. One of the suspects entered and pretended to be a customer while the other served as look out.
The suspect asked for ice and when the store clerk said there is no more ice, the man picked up a bottle of liquor and while pretending to pay, declared a holdup and took at least P10,000 cash sales from the store.
The suspects fled after the burglary.
Police are tracking down the robbers.
